Conclusion
Real-time clocks are essential components in a wide array of applications, providing critical timekeeping functions that enhance the functionality of electronic devices. Their low power consumption, accuracy, and ability to interface seamlessly with microcontrollers make them indispensable in modern electronics. As technology advances, RTCs are expected to evolve further, incorporating improved accuracy, integration with other sensors, and enhanced power management features, thereby expanding their applicability across various industries.
